"Lois & Clark: The New Adventures of Superman" is a memorable reimagining of the beloved Superman lore, bringing a contemporary twist to the timeless superhero narrative. This series premiered in the early 90s and stands out as a lavish tribute to the original Superman television show that first captured audiences four decades earlier. The show intricately explores the early adult life of Clark Kent, played by Dean Cain, as he navigates his dual identity while establishing himself in the bustling city of Metropolis. This new portrayal offers a fresh perspective on the iconic hero, emphasizing his growth not just as Superman, but also as a young man seeking love, purpose, and acceptance in a busy city.
Central to the storyline is the dynamic relationship between Clark Kent and the fiercely ambitious journalist Lois Lane, portrayed by the talented Teri Hatcher. Their chemistry sparks the narrative, with Lois completely unaware of Clark's secret identity as Superman. As they work together at the world-famous Daily Planet newspaper, audiences are treated to a delightful mix of romance, humor, and adventure that epitomizes the essence of their partnership. The show's well-crafted writing captures the essence of both characters, showcasing Lois's tenacity and intellect alongside Clark's charm and integrity as he learns to balance his responsibilities as a reporter and a superhero.
The series not only delves into the professional challenges faced by Lois and Clark at the Daily Planet but also highlights significant themes of trust, love, and the battle between personal ambition and societal responsibility. Viewers are drawn into their captivating world filled with villainous threats that Superman must thwart, while also experiencing the ups and downs of their blossoming relationship. "Lois & Clark: The New Adventures of Superman" ultimately captures the heart of the Superman mythology, offering a unique blend of romance and superhero action that endures in the memories of fans.
